Hi there! I was wondering, and I'm not sure if you've answered this already, but how many cats is an embarrassing number? because at one time I had 15 cats. No joke. don't know where they came from... Other questions I have are these: Have you ever critiqued another author's work? Has your work ever been critiqued? Are any of your friends authors? Do they write different genres from you? Sorry, I'm inquisitive. :p
Shannon Messenger
Wow, 15 is a LOT of cats. At one point we had 11 (we were taking care of a mama cat and her kittens) but at the moment we currently have 5. Part of the reason I stick with "an embarrassing number" in my bio is because the number changes. This year we lost two kitties and went from 6 to 4, then adopted a new one and went back to 5.
As for critiquing, yes, I used to be critique partners with several writers who are now published authors, and they did the same for me. And we still read for each other from time to time, though now that I have things like deadlines and an editor, it tends to be more that they'll give me quick opinions on a chapter I'm struggling with--or help me brainstorm a plot thing--and leave the larger edit notes to my editor, since...that's an editor's job. I'm also lucky to be friends with many authors who write a wide variety of things. But I'll hold off on listing any names because somehow that feels strange.
